高分子塑性材料在煤矿堵漏风中的应用研究

为了解决传统混凝土材料凝固时间长、粉尘浓度大、回弹率高等影响井下通风密闭性的问题.提出了将KA-GK加强型堵漏风用密封酯材料应用于煤矿井下巷道密封堵漏.对该材料的制备要求、原料参数等进行了分析.根据井下的实际应用表明,新型高分子塑性材料在结构强度上和传统混凝土基本一致,但在密封性、施工效率方面具有显著的优势.
Research on the Application of Polymer Plastic Materials in Coal Mine Air Leakage Control
In order to solve the problems of long solidification time,high dust concentration,and high rebound rate of traditional concrete materials that affect underground ventilation and airtightness,this paper proposed the application of KA-GK reinforced sealing ester material for sealing and plugging air leaks in underground coal mine tunnels.An analysis was conducted on the preparation requirements and raw material parameters of the material.According to practical applications underground,the new polymer plastic material has similar structural strength to traditional concrete,but has significant advantages in sealing and construction efficiency.
